The video explores the concept of exoskeletons in invertebrates, focusing on centipedes, ants, and crustaceans. It explains how these creatures use their exoskeletons for support, movement, and protection. The video also highlights the challenges faced by crustaceans like spider crabs as they grow and need to shed their shells to develop larger armor.
